I can see how that would work but I know many people don't use any of those. I, for example, only use gmail accounts.

Also, AOL mail is free now.


1) Does the forum sign up process require email validation? I cant remember if it does or doesn't.

2) Is it possible to 'lock out' new members from making a new topic until they post in an 'Introduce Yourself' forum?
Just have people say something like "Hi, My name is Jason."
I would think that would verify true accounts.
